首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Maven gpg插件找不到工件

Maven GPG插件是用于在Maven构建过程中对工件进行签名的插件。它使用GnuPG(GNU Privacy Guard)来生成和管理密钥对,并使用密钥对对工件进行数字签名,以确保工件的完整性和真实性。

Maven GPG插件的主要作用是为了确保工件的安全性和可信度。通过对工件进行数字签名,可以验证工件是否被篡改过,以及工件的来源是否可信。这对于开发者和用户来说都非常重要,特别是在分发和使用开源软件时。

Maven GPG插件的使用一般包括以下步骤:

  1. 配置GPG密钥:首先需要生成GPG密钥对,并将公钥上传到密钥服务器或者其他可信的地方。
  2. 配置Maven项目:在Maven项目的pom.xml文件中添加GPG插件的配置,包括密钥的位置和其他相关参数。
  3. 执行签名:运行Maven命令来执行GPG插件的签名操作,将工件进行数字签名。
  4. 发布工件:将签名后的工件发布到Maven仓库或其他适当的位置,供其他开发者和用户使用。

Maven GPG插件的优势包括:

  1. 安全性:通过数字签名,确保工件的完整性和真实性,防止工件被篡改或冒充。
  2. 可信度:数字签名可以验证工件的来源是否可信,提供了对开源软件的信任度。
  3. 便捷性:集成到Maven构建过程中,使用简单方便,无需额外的工具和步骤。

Maven GPG插件的应用场景包括:

  1. 开源软件发布:对于开源软件的发布者来说,使用Maven GPG插件可以为发布的工件提供可信度,增加用户对软件的信任度。
  2. 内部工件发布:对于企业内部的工件发布,使用Maven GPG插件可以确保工件的完整性和真实性,防止工件被篡改或冒充。
  3. Maven仓库管理:对于维护Maven仓库的人员来说,使用Maven GPG插件可以确保仓库中的工件的安全性和可信度。

腾讯云提供了一系列与Maven GPG插件相关的产品和服务,包括:

  1. 云密钥管理系统(KMS):用于管理和存储GPG密钥对,确保密钥的安全性和可信度。详情请参考:腾讯云密钥管理系统(KMS)
  2. 云原生应用平台(TKE):提供了一套完整的云原生应用开发和运行环境,包括Maven构建和部署工具链。详情请参考:腾讯云原生应用平台(TKE)
  3. 云存储服务(COS):用于存储和分发Maven仓库中的工件,确保工件的安全性和可靠性。详情请参考:腾讯云存储服务(COS)

希望以上信息能够对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

HTTPS基础知识介绍

一 介绍 HTTPS 之前,我们先回顾一下 HTTP 协议。HTTP 超文本传输协议,它是无状态的、简单快速、基于 TCP 的可靠传输协议。既然 HTTP 协议这么好,那为什么又冒出来了一个 HTTPS ?主要是因为 HTTP 明文传输的数据,这就造成了很大的安全隐患。在网络传输过程中,只要数据包被人劫持,那就相当于赤身全裸的暴露在他人面前,毫无半点隐私可言。想象一下,假设你连了一个不可信的 WIFI,正好又使用了某个支付软件进行了支付操作,那么你的密码可能就到别人手里去了,后果可想而知。公共网络环境就是这样,给你带来便利的同时,也充满了挑战与风险。对于小白用户,你不能期望他有多高的网络安全意识。这样的问题产品应该通过技术手段,让我们的产品变得更安全,从源头来控制风险。这就是HTTPS协议诞生的背景。

02
领券